Theological Foundations: Principles and Practices

Jesus' teachings consistently emphasized faith (Matthew 6:25-34), providing a foundational framework. Proverbs 3:5-6 highlights trusting in the Lord above one's understanding; Isaiah 41:10 assures God's presence and strength; John 14:1 emphasizes trust in God and Jesus; and Matthew 28:20 promises God's continued presence, reinforcing divine providence. Hebrews 11, the "Hall of Faith," catalogs individuals whose unwavering faith led to remarkable achievements, illustrating faith as active engagement with God, not passive belief. These scriptures provide a theological bedrock for the application of faith's principles throughout various aspects of life. Understanding these foundational principles provides a lens through which to interpret the case studies below, revealing a consistent thread of trust, obedience, and reliance on divine action underpinning the experiences of these biblical figures.

Biblical Exemplars of Faith: A Case Study Analysis

Numerous biblical narratives illustrate faith's dynamic interaction with uncertainty. Abraham's obedience in leaving his homeland (Genesis 12:1-4) exemplifies pistis – complete trust in God's promises despite uncertainty. His action demonstrates obedience as a crucial aspect of faith, a direct response to God's command. The covenant subsequently established reinforces the reciprocal nature of trust between God and humanity. Moses' leadership during the Exodus (Exodus 3-14) showcases divine providence, demonstrating faith in God's power to overcome seemingly insurmountable obstacles. The construction of the Ark by Noah (Genesis 6-9) displays anticipatory obedience, acting on faith in a future event, highlighting faith's operation even amidst the unknown and seemingly impossible. David's victory over Goliath (1 Samuel 17) exemplifies faith as a source of courage, enabling him to confront overwhelming odds. This underscores how faith can empower individuals to overcome fear and self-doubt. Applying the social cognitive theory, we see that David’s self-efficacy was dramatically strengthened by his faith, allowing him to believe in his ability to succeed despite the seemingly insurmountable odds.

Further examples include Peter's attempt to walk on water (Matthew 14:22-33), illustrating faith's capacity for both success and failure, emphasizing the ongoing human struggle against doubt. The narratives of the woman with the issue of blood (Mark 5:25-34), the centurion (Matthew 8:5-13), and the Syrophoenician woman (Mark 7:24-30) showcase faith transcending societal and geographical boundaries. The thief on the cross (Luke 23:39-43) demonstrates faith's transformative power even at life's end, showing the potential for redemption through even last-minute acts of faith. These diverse narratives demonstrate the multifaceted nature of faith and its applicability across various contexts and challenges.

Conclusion and Recommendations

This exploration reveals faith as a dynamic process of trust and obedience, not a static belief. Biblical narratives demonstrate faith's transformative power to overcome adversity and achieve seemingly impossible goals. Further research could investigate the psychological and sociological dimensions of faith, exploring its correlation with well-being and its role in community building and social justice. Applying these principles in contemporary life necessitates critical self-reflection, cultivating trust, and consistent engagement with scripture and theological understanding. Individuals can foster a robust faith capable of navigating life’s uncertainties and fostering positive change by embracing the principles of trust, obedience, and perseverance. The power of faith lies in its capacity to shape character, inspire hope, and effect transformation in individuals and communities. A continuous process of learning, reflection, and application of biblical principles in everyday life is essential for developing and strengthening faith.
